You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@avalon.apache.org by do...@apache.org on 2001/11/06 00:38:18 UTC
cvs commit: jakarta-avalon-excalibur build.xml
donaldp 01/11/05 15:38:18
Modified: . build.xml
Log:
Fix up build so it does copy munge compile copy delete the JDBC classes every build.
Instead it just copy compiles.
Revision Changes Path
1.75 +7 -36 jakarta-avalon-excalibur/build.xml
Index: build.xml
===================================================================
RCS file: /home/cvs/jakarta-avalon-excalibur/build.xml,v
retrieving revision 1.74
retrieving revision 1.75
diff -u -r1.74 -r1.75
--- build.xml 2001/11/05 13:45:27 1.74
+++ build.xml 2001/11/05 23:38:18 1.75
@@ -209,26 +209,12 @@
<mkdir dir="${build.scratchpad}"/>
<copy file="${java.dir}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.java"
- tofile="${java.dir}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.tmp"
- filtering="no"
- overwrite="yes"
- preservelastmodified="yes"/>
- <copy file="${java.dir}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.tmp"
- tofile="${java.dir}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.java"
- filtering="yes"
- overwrite="yes"
- preservelastmodified="yes"/>
+ tofile="${build.src}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.java"
+ filtering="yes"/>
<copy file="${java.dir}/org/apache/avalon/excalibur/datasource/JdbcConnection.java"
- tofile="${java.dir}/org/apache/avalon/excalibur/datasource/JdbcConnection.tmp"
- filtering="no"
- overwrite="yes"
- preservelastmodified="yes"/>
- <copy file="${java.dir}/org/apache/avalon/excalibur/datasource/JdbcConnection.tmp"
- tofile="${java.dir}/org/apache/avalon/excalibur/datasource/JdbcConnection.java"
- filtering="yes"
- overwrite="yes"
- preservelastmodified="yes"/>
+ tofile="${build.src}/org/apache/avalon/excalibur/datasource/JdbcConnection.java"
+ filtering="yes"/>
<copy todir="${build.scratchpad}">
<fileset dir="${scratchpad.dir}">
@@ -258,6 +244,7 @@
deprecation="${build.deprecation}">
<classpath refid="project.class.path" />
<src path="${test.dir}"/>
+ <src path="${build.src}"/>
<exclude name="org/apache/avalon/excalibur/datasource/J2eeDataSource.java"
unless="j2ee.present"/>
<exclude name="org/apache/avalon/excalibur/datasource/InformixDataSource.java"
@@ -269,7 +256,6 @@
unless="xpath.present"/>
<exclude name="org/apache/avalon/excalibur/datasource/Jdbc3Connection.java"
unless="jdbc3.present"/>
- <exclude name="java/sql/Savepoint.java" if="jdbc3.present"/>
<exclude name="org/apache/avalon/excalibur/logger/factory/ServletTargetFactory.java"
unless="servlet.present"/>
<exclude name="org/apache/avalon/excalibur/logger/factory/JMSTargetFactory.java"
@@ -278,6 +264,8 @@
unless="datasource.present"/>
<exclude name="org/apache/avalon/excalibur/xml/xpath/JaxenProcessorImpl.java"
unless="jaxen.present"/>
+ <exclude name="org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.java"/>
+ <exclude name="org/apache/avalon/excalibur/datasource/JdbcConnection.java"/>
</javac>
<javac srcdir="${scratchpad.dir}"
@@ -294,23 +282,6 @@
<classpath refid="project.class.path" />
</rmic>
- <copy file="${java.dir}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.tmp"
- tofile="${java.dir}/org/apache/avalon/excalibur/datasource/AbstractJdbcConnection.java"
- filtering="no"
- overwrite="yes"
- preservelastmodified="yes"/>
-
- <copy file="${java.dir}/org/apache/avalon/excalibur/datasource/JdbcConnection.tmp"
- tofile="${java.dir}/org/apache/avalon/excalibur/datasource/JdbcConnection.java"
- filtering="no"
- overwrite="yes"
- preservelastmodified="yes"/>
-
- <delete>
- <fileset dir="${java.dir}/org/apache/avalon/excalibur/datasource">
- <include name="*.tmp"/>
- </fileset>
- </delete>
</target>
<target name="test" depends="check"/>
--
To unsubscribe, e-mail: <ma...@jakarta.apache.org>
For additional commands, e-mail: <ma...@jakarta.apache.org>